Ecevit/Kissinger
4
K:
Yeah, but that can only arise from the negotiations.
E:
We were not given this opportunity up until now and we are not trying
to seek it through our rights in the Treaty.
K:
Yes, but I'm afraid you may be bringing about a situation in which
exactly the opposite happens.
E:
No, I don't think SO. Anyway we have reached the night. We have
doubts about what they would do in the night. Tomorrow we can make
a decision. We can announce the time. I have no doubt about that.
I mean, the Cabinet accepts the principle. Tomorrow we will
announce it.
K:
All right. Well, --
E:
We
K:
After I have had an answer from Greece, I will be in touch with you.
E:
All right, Dr. Kissinger.
K:
Thank you, Mr. Prime Minister.
